10. The Gut-Brain Connection: Nurturing Your Microbiome

Your gut health is intimately linked to your overall health and even your mood. Support a healthy gut by:

  • Eating probiotic-rich foods: Yogurt (if you tolerate dairy), kefir, sauerkraut.
  • Eating prebiotic-rich foods: Onions, garlic, bananas.
  • Limiting processed foods and sugar.

The Foundation: Mindful Movement and Metabolic Mastery

The cornerstone of accelerated health lies in mindful movement and metabolic mastery. Our bodies are designed for motion, and a sedentary lifestyle is a significant detriment to overall well-being. We must move, not just for the sake of it, but with purpose and intention. Consider it a symphony of movement, where each note played contributes to the harmonious whole.

Optimizing Exercise for Enhanced Vitality:

Instead of random workouts, we approach exercise with a strategic approach. We incorporate a multifaceted approach, weaving together elements of strength training, cardiovascular activity, and flexibility. Strength training, essential for building and maintaining muscle mass, is a powerful ally in boosting metabolism and improving bone density. We focus on compound exercises, such as squats, deadlifts, and bench presses, which engage multiple muscle groups simultaneously, maximizing efficiency and calorie expenditure.

Cardiovascular activity, the lifeblood of a healthy heart, varies depending on the individual. High-intensity interval training (HIIT) offers remarkable benefits in a short timeframe. These bursts of intense effort, interspersed with periods of recovery, are extraordinarily effective at burning fat and improving cardiovascular fitness. We remember the importance of low-intensity steady-state cardio like brisk walking or cycling, especially on recovery days, to improve endurance and support the body's recovery processes.

Flexibility and mobility are equally crucial. They contribute to the ease of movement, reducing risk of injury, and enhancing overall physical performance. We incorporate yoga, Pilates, or simple stretching routines into our regimen, focusing on lengthening muscles and improving joint range of motion.

The Power of Sleep and Stress Management: Harmonizing the Internal Landscape

Our bodies are intricate ecosystems, and for them to function optimally, the environment must be conducive to thriving. Sleep and stress management are the key elements that we must prioritize.

Cultivating Restful Sleep:

Sleep is not merely a period of inactivity; it is a crucial time for the body to repair, rejuvenate, and consolidate memories. We acknowledge that adequate sleep is an absolute requirement for accelerated health and wellness. Aim for seven to nine hours of quality sleep each night. Establish a consistent sleep schedule, going to bed and waking up around the same time each day, even on weekends. This helps to regulate the body's natural sleep-wake cycle (circadian rhythm).

Create a sleep-conducive environment. Make your bedroom dark, quiet, and cool. Minimize exposure to blue light from electronic devices before bed. Consider using blackout curtains, a white noise machine, and ensuring a comfortable room temperature.

Practice relaxation techniques. Incorporate relaxation practices such as meditation, deep breathing exercises, or gentle stretching. These practices can quiet the mind and prepare the body for sleep.

Effective Stress Management Strategies:

Chronic stress is a formidable threat to both physical and mental health. It can elevate cortisol levels, which leads to weight gain, hormonal imbalances, and weakened immune function. We embrace proactive strategies for managing stress and fostering resilience.

Develop healthy coping mechanisms. We make space for activities that bring joy and relaxation, such as spending time in nature, reading, pursuing hobbies, or socializing with loved ones. The main idea is to have an outlet to provide a contrast to stressors in life.

Practice mindfulness and meditation. These practices help to cultivate awareness of the present moment, enabling us to manage stress more effectively. We can use guided meditation apps, attend mindfulness workshops, or incorporate mindful breathing exercises into our daily routines.

Prioritize time for social connections. Strong social support networks can act as a buffer against stress. We prioritize nurturing relationships with friends and family, and actively seek support when needed.
